What is the Bait and Switch Scam, and how are Seasons Holidays PLC using it to deceive their timeshare members? Let's first start with some evidence. Seasons Keys members are bombarded with generic emails from Seasons Holidays telling them they must travel to Bristol for a meeting. Email from Seasons: "As we are nearing completion of several properties, it is crucial that we have your relevant paperwork on file. Our records indicate that we do not have this documentation; as we do not have your paperwork, we will be unable to distribute any funds to you, nor will you be eligible for the Alternative product ( a further term of holidays), which is subject to approval and availability."

Bait and Switch is prohibited under The Consumer Protection from Unfair Trading Regulations 2008. Bait and Switch is a form of marketing where a business will lead consumers to believe that they are visiting them for a particular reason, such as the distribution of funds from the Keys membership or a free extension of their existing membership, and then take that opportunity to sell them something completely different.
In this case, if you visit Seasons head office in Bristol, Seasons salesperson and local lad Richie will give you all the reasons under the sun why your Keys membership isn't sellable and then proceed to offer you an upgrade into a lodge at Slaley Hall or Seasons loyalty night package. Classic 'bait and switch'.
